The Significance of Professional Engineers Day

This day serves as a platform to acknowledge the dedication, expertise, and profound impact of professional engineers across various fields. From awe-inspiring architectural wonders to life-altering technological innovations, engineers have left an indelible mark on our world. By celebrating this special day, we honor the tireless efforts of these unsung heroes who work diligently to enhance our lives, often without fanfare.

FAQ
What is the significance of Professional Engineers Day?
Professional Engineers Day recognizes the achievements and contributions of professional engineers in various fields, including architecture, construction, and technology.
How do engineers celebrate Professional Engineers Day?
Engineers celebrate Professional Engineers Day by attending conferences, seminars, and workshops, and by participating in community service projects.
What are some emerging trends in engineering?
Emerging trends in engineering include the use of artificial intelligence, sustainable design, and green technology, which are transforming various industries and improving peoples lives.
What skills do professional engineers need?
Professional engineers need strong technical skills,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ication skills to succeed in their careers.
How can I become a professional engineer?
You can become a professional engineer by earning a degree in engineering or a related field, gaining work experience, and obtaining a professional engineering license through a state licensing board.
